The NZD/USD pair retraced its recent gains from the previous session, hovering around 0.5720 during early European trading on Friday. The technical analysis of the daily chart suggests a bullish bias as the pair remains within an ascending channel pattern. However, the 14-day Relative Strength Index (RSI) has dipped below the 50 level, signaling a weakening bullish momentum.
Additionally, the NZD/USD pair remains below the nine-day Exponential Moving Average (EMA), suggesting weakening short-term price momentum. However, with the nine-day EMA still positioned above the 50-day EMA, the broader bullish trend remains intact, indicating the potential for continued recovery.
On the upside, a decisive break above the nine-day EMA at 0.5738 could bolster short-term momentum, potentially pushing the NZD/USD pair toward its three-month high of 0.5832, last reached on March 18. Beyond this level, the next key resistance lies near the upper boundary of the ascending channel, around 0.5900.
A break below the 50-day EMA at 0.5718 could weaken medium-term momentum, intensifying downside pressure on the NZD/USD pair. This could lead to a test of the psychological support at 0.5700, with the lower boundary of the ascending channel near 0.5670 as the next key level. A breakdown below this channel would reinforce the bearish bias, potentially driving the pair toward the monthly low of 0.5593, recorded on March 3.
